Unleash your talent and redefine what’s possible. _**Job Description:**_ Parsons has a career opportunity for an amazingly talented **Office Engineer - Rail and Transit** to join our team! In this role you will get to work on an exciting mega project in the Rail and Transit Industry. With minimal supervision, independently performs all aspects of field engineering assignments including development of plans, schedules, contracts, procedures, and construction methods and systems for an assigned project, or a designated area of a large project.
